Kuradissar
Kuradissar is an island in Käsmu, Haljala Parish, Lääne-Viru County. Kuradissar is situated nearby to the hamlet Lobi, as well as near Lahe.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Võsu is a small borough in Lääne-Viru County, in Haljala Parish, in Estonia. It was the administrative centre of Vihula Parish. As of the 2011 census, the settlement's population was 334.
